Job Description
Lead Electrical Engineer in the Central Engineering team based in Newport, Wales, UK.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ead the design and document circuits for new projects.
- Lead Design Reviews with multi-functional teams.
- Select and detail new parts. Request quotations and place orders for prototype and pre‑production builds.
- Work closely with and manage suppliers to ensure all design requirements are specified and achieved.
- Address and resolve product issues through the product lifecycle phases.
- Develop the assembly procedures (Operational Method Sheets) for new assemblies, so the prototype assembly proceeds smoothly.
Qualifications & Experience
- Bachelor’s degree or Master’s degree in Electrical Engineering (or a related discipline) or hold equivalent level of qualification.
- Strong documentation skills, with knowledge of AutoCAD, Visio, Excel, and other Microsoft365 tools.
- Experience in system‑level Electrical Design Engineering with power distribution and communication circuits.
- The candidate must be a self‑motivated engineer with the ability to multi‑task and work independently as part of a team.
- You will also have the inherent desire to expand their knowledge through self‑study and continuing education and training.
- Strong communication skills are needed for extensive interaction with vendors and team members.
Desirable Experience
- Development and installation experience with safety circuits.
- Semiconductor‑industry experience is a plus (knowledge of SEMI standards).
- Familiarity with mains supply safety and design protocols. Familiarity with regulatory compliance is a plus.
- PLC implementation and programming skills are a plus.
- Ability to diagnose problems and hands‑on problem‑solving experience for sophisticated electrical subsystems.
- Enjoy working on leading‑edge technologies.
